Understanding SR22 Insurance

SR22 insurance is not a type of insurance policy but rather a certificate that proves a driver has the minimum required auto insurance coverage. It is often mandated by the state after certain driving infractions, such as:

  • Driving under the influence (DUI) or driving while intoxicated (DWI)
  • Serious traffic violations
  • Accidents without insurance coverage
  • Multiple traffic offenses in a short time period

SR22 Insurance Requirements in Salt Lake City

In Salt Lake City, as in the rest of Utah, individuals who need to file an SR22 must ensure they meet specific state mandates. The requirements typically include:

  • Maintaining the SR22 certificate for a minimum period, often three years
  • Continuously holding the minimum liability insurance coverage
  • No lapses in coverage throughout the required period

How to Obtain SR22 Insurance in Salt Lake City

Obtaining SR22 insurance in Salt Lake City involves several steps:

  1. Contact an Insurance Provider: Reach out to an insurance provider authorized to issue SR22 certificates. It is crucial to ensure that the provider is licensed to operate in Utah.
  2. File the SR22 Certificate: The insurance provider will file the SR22 form with the state's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) on behalf of the driver.
  3. Pay the Associated Fees: There are filing fees associated with obtaining SR22 insurance, which the driver is responsible for paying.
  4. Maintain the Insurance: Once filed, it is the driver's responsibility to maintain the insurance coverage without any interruptions.

Impact on Insurance Premiums

One of the significant concerns for individuals required to obtain SR22 insurance is the potential impact on their insurance premiums. Typically, obtaining an SR22 can result in increased premiums due to the high-risk status associated with the need for this certificate. Key factors affecting premiums include:

  • The individual's driving record
  • The nature of the offense that led to the SR22 requirement
  • Age and type of vehicle
